A clothing store is selling a shirt for a discounted price of $43.61. If the discount is 11%, what was the original price, in do
svet-max [94.6K]

Answer:

$49

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that the discounted price is $43.61 and this was at an 11% discount

hence the discounted price represents 100% - 11% = 89% of the original price.

if:

89% of original price = $43.61

1% of original price = $(43.61 / 89)

100% of original price = $(43.61 / 89) x 100 = $49

A line passes through the point (3,4) and has a slope of 7. Write an equation for this line
Dmitry [639]

Answer:

y = 7x - 17

Step-by-step explanation:

If you graph the coordinate (3,4) and then apply the slope (7 up / 1 down) , you will end up passing through the point (0,-17) on the y line. The point the line passes on the y line would be the y intercept.

Once you have all the necessary information, you put it into a y=mx+b form. m being the rate or slope, and b being the y-intercept.
